Comments (2)
I agree with this. We need to improve the explanation of how to determine whether or not a change is major/minor/patch in the dictionary development guidelines, something like:
- major: incompatible change in data name meaning
- minor: addition of one or more new data names (except those already implied by existing names, i.e.
_su
) - version: improvement in existing data names, fixing of bugs
We are unlikely to ever change the major number as far as I can tell.
from cif_core.
I filed the proposal to provide explanation on the version number selection as a separate issue: COMCIFS/comcifs.github.io#17.
from cif_core.
Related Issues (20)
- cif_core.dic: unclear semantics of the '_atom_type.oxidation_number' data item
- cif_core.dic: definition class of dREL function definitions
- "photons per second" - unit with no underscores? HOT 3
- Add elemental composition of the specimen HOT 13
- Develop a dictionary release schedule and policy HOT 7
- temp_enum.cif: potentially missing negative exponent in the desciptions of some units of measure HOT 2
- cif_core.dic: update the dREL code of the _atom_type_scat.dispersion_* data items
- Should `_type.purpose Key` data items be case-sensitive? HOT 3
- [RELEASE ISSUE]: Checklist for next release of cif_core HOT 11
- Add a disclaimer about the historic misuse of the _atom_site_symmetry_multiplicity data item HOT 1
- Rename the default branch from 'master' to 'main' HOT 1
- The spelling of the term "Jones faithful notation" HOT 9
- Capturing variance-covariance matrices in CIF HOT 2
- What is meant by "diffraction experiment" in `DIFFRN`? HOT 3
- Expand meaning of `_database.dataset_DOI` to encompass raw data DOIs
- Linking refinements to the data sets used
- Can the content type of `_journal_index.id` be changed from "Integer" to "Word"? HOT 3
- Contradictory definition of _citation_editor.id HOT 1
- Need new data names?: _atom_site_aniso.beta_11, _22, _33, _12, _13, _23 HOT 9
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from cif_core.